It's a strange one. John Terry was stripped of the England captaincy for the allegations against him, Fabio Capello resigned over it. He's now back in the squad, although Gerrard is the captain, you have to wonder why the FA have changed their stance. It appeared they were suggesting that Terry was guilty - there was no other reason to strip him of the captains armband otherwise. Woy has stated that Terry is "innocent until proven guilty" and so he should. Ferdinand simply isn't fit enough to cope with tournament football - Sir Alex stated that Rio was unable to play two games in a week because of his back injury. Simple really.
